Who Needs To Comply?
- All employers (regardless of company size) must have I-9 forms on file for all of their employees.
Why Is Compliance Critical?
- In 2013, the agency conducted over 3,000 I-9 inspections, collecting more than $15 million in fines.
- Federal audits of employers' Form I-9 practices have increased considerably over the last few years.
- Most employers average at least five errors per I-9 form, and fines range from $110 to $1,100 per each violation.
- When mistakes are found during an audit, the result can be fines, penalties, and even criminal sanctions – not to mention damage to your company's reputation.
